Hilton Honors

Hilton Honors is the loyalty scheme for Hilton hotels, which includes these brands: Canopy, Conrad, Curio, DoubleTree, Embassy Suites, Hampton, Hilton, Homewood Suites, Home2 Suites, LXR, Motto, Spark, Tapestry Collection, Tru and Waldorf Astoria.
